Cops And Krispy Kreme Pair Up For Special Olympics in Athens

Krispy Kreme Doughnuts and the Law Enforcement Torch Run for Special Olympics have partnered to raise awareness and money for Special Olympics Georgia's Athletes.

Yes, we all know the stereotype about finding cops in doughnut shops.

But how about cops on doughnut shops?

This weekend, Krispy Kreme Doughnuts and the Law Enforcement Torch Run for Special Olympics have partnered to raise awareness and money for Special Olympics Georgia’s Athletes.

Police officers from area law enforcement departments will take to the roofs of Krispy Kreme stores across the state to raise money from customers for the cause.

The officers will eat, sleep, play and otherwise entertain patrons from 6 a.m. June 8 through 6 p.m. June 10.

Last year's statewide efforts raised more than $85,000 for the Law Enforcement Torch Run for Special Olympics Georgia.
